Transaction 3dfc352cd67d83fa54f3a092e027431984e18f877699f7c718fba0165322b2f8
1 Input
1 Output
-
3dfc352cd67d83fa54f3a092e027431984e18f877699f7c718fba0165322b2f8:0
- value
- 2660593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1224445a483d93c5d069a8c46c7ae0dbc9bf10f0 OP_EQUAL
- address
- 33LwXsYPtdvMrTZKGYroZpzxEyj9Ar8Hut